The National Flood Insurance Program (NFIP) has been extended through Nov. 30, averting a possible lapse in coverage for millions of Americans at peak hurricane season.
However, National Association of Realtors President Elizabeth Mendenhall said there is still more work to be done to ensure people in more than 20,000 communities nationwide who depend on the NFIP are not put at risk for a lapse in flood insurance.
